Beethoven's Serioso quartet is one of the shortest and most compact of all his string quartets. Written in 1810, Beethoven wrote the work was meant 'for a small circle of connoisseurs and should never be publicly performed', as he thought audiences of the time would not be ready for its dramatic, colourful style.
